What is a Webmethods Remote job?

A Webmethods Remote job involves working with Software AG's WebMethods platform to integrate applications, data, and systems, but in a remote setting. Professionals in this role typically handle API management, B2B integration, and workflow automation while collaborating with teams virtually. Responsibilities can include designing, developing, and troubleshooting integration solutions. Remote work allows flexibility while still requiring strong communication and problem-solving skills. Companies hiring for these roles often seek experience with WebMethods components like Integration Server, Trading Networks, and MFT.

Job description

·       Purpose:

In the initial phase, this role will primarily focus on migrating existing integrations from webMethods to SAP Cloud Platform Integration (CPI).
These integrations will be reimplemented in CPI to ensure a controlled and future-proof transition.

From CPI, messages will be routed to the existing enterprise integration platform, IBM App Connect Enterprise (ACE), and vice versa. The role therefore sits at the heart of a hybrid integration landscape, ensuring reliable message flow and compatibility between legacy and modern integration technologies.

The objective is to support a gradual migration strategy while maintaining operational stability, data integrity, and business continuity throughout the transition.
